In Duck Key, United States, January weather showcases a blend of mild temperatures and occasional rain. The maximum temperature reaches a pleasant 26°C (80°F), while the average temperature hovers around 22°C (71°F), offering a comfortable winter escape. However, the month can see cooler spells with a minimum temperature dipping to 11°C (52°F). With 24 mm (1.0 in) of precipitation over approximately 4 days, the humidity remains relatively high at 81%, contributing to a refreshing atmosphere. This combination of conditions makes Duck Key an inviting destination for those seeking warmth and nature during the winter months.

In January, Duck Key experiences a relatively dry start to the year, with only 24 mm (1.0 in) of precipitation recorded over just 4 days. This modest rainfall sets the tone for the early months, as February sees a slight increase to 28 mm (1.1 in), while March dips back down to 22 mm (0.9 in). The trend shifts dramatically in the following months, with April's precipitation more than doubling to 44 mm (1.7 in) and May hitting a peak of 142 mm (5.6 in), representing the onset of the wetter season. As summer approaches, the skies remain generous, showcasing the area's seasonal patterns where precipitation continues to rise, peaking in September with a remarkable 200 mm (7.9 in) over 18 days of rain. The transition from the drier winter months to a vibrant rainy season highlights the distinctive climate rhythms of Duck Key, offering a unique blend of sunshine and showers.
